Are there any low-cost or free immigration legal services available for residents of Keysville?
Yes, while direct free legal clinics in Keysville itself are limited, residents can access services through organizations like the Legal Aid Justice Center, which serves Central Virginia and may offer outreach or remote consultations. The Virginia Poverty Law Center also provides resources and referrals. For those who qualify based on income, pro bono representation may be available through these networks. Additionally, some private attorneys in the region operate on a sliding scale fee basis, making their services more accessible to the Keysville community.
What should I bring to my first consultation with an immigration attorney in Keysville?
You should bring any and all immigration-related documents, including your passport, I-94 arrival/departure record, any prior USCIS notices (Receipt Notices, Approval Notices, or Denials), work permits, and if applicable, court documents from any removal proceedings. Also bring identification for all family members involved, proof of your address in Keysville or Charlotte County (like a utility bill or lease), and any criminal records, even if they were expunged. Having this organized will help the attorney assess your case efficiently, which is especially important if you need to travel to a larger city for the appointment.
How does living in a rural area like Keysville impact the processing of my immigration application?
Living in Keysville primarily affects the logistical aspects of your case. While immigration is federal, your biometrics appointment will likely be at the USCIS Application Support Center in Richmond, a significant drive away. Furthermore, any required interviews for family-based green cards or citizenship will be conducted at the USCIS Field Office in Norfolk, which requires careful travel planning. A local attorney familiar with these geographic challenges can help you prepare for these trips and manage timelines, ensuring that distance does not lead to missed deadlines or appointments that could jeopardize your case.
